The first victorious title is Jesus: King of Glory! (Psalm 24: 8 -10) • Pre-incarnate declaration about this King • Glory is connected to this King in the OT (expression from the 1960’s) • Triumphant entries of this King in the OT & NT (Psalm 24: 8, 9 & Ephesians 4: 8 -10) • Pre-incarnate description about Jesus, this King (Psalm 110: 1) • This King is a descendent of David & declared the Son of God (Romans 1: 3 -4) • The reign of this King of Glory is forever (Luke 1: 33)

The second victorious title is Jesus, King of Kings! (Revelation 19: 16) 16 On his robe and on his thigh He has this name written: king of kings and lord of lords - Revelation 19: 16 • This King comes in great splendor (Revelation 19: 11 -16) • This King has all authority (Matthew 28: 18; John 5: 22, 27; 1 Corinthians 15: 24 -28)

Who Jesus is & how He wants to be involved in many vocations! To the Astronomer He is the Bright & Morning Star. To the Botanist He is the Lily of the Valley. To the Clothier He is the Robe of Righteousness. To the Doctor He is the Great Physician. To the Educator He is the Master Teacher. To the Firefighter He is the Living Water. To the Gravedigger He is the Resurrection. To the Horticulturalist He is the Rose of Sharon. To the Interpreter He is the Alpha & Omega. To the Judge He is the Advocate. To the King He is the King of Kings. To the Linguist He is the Word.
